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ree/ in Occupational Health & Safety, Environmental Engineering/Master's degree in Safety, Environmental Management, or Industrial Hygiene.
  • Minimum 7–10 years in HSE roles, with at least 3–5 years in managerial or leadership positions. Proven experience in high-risk manufacturing industries.
  • Has General OH&S Expert Certification (Ahli K3 Umum), Auditor certification for ISO 14001, ISO 45001, and SMK3 is a plus.
  • Strong understanding of Indonesian and International HSE laws, regulations, and standards.
  • Familiar with ISO 14001, ISO 45001, ISO 9001, and SMK3 implementation.
  • Competence in risk assessment methodologies, incident investigation, and emergency response planning.
  • Strong Leadership and team management.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Analytical and problem-solving skills for data-driven decision-making.
  • Ability to develop and implement safety culture programs.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and HSE reporting tools. Capability in data analysis, machine learning and AI will be an advantage.
  • Fluent in English (written and spoken).
  • Willingness to travel and work in remote project sites.
  • Strong commitment to ethical practices, integrity and anti-bribery compliance.

Responsibilities :

  • Lead the HSE section and support the HSEQ department head in developing strategic safety objectives.
  • Provide guidance and leadership to HSE coordinator.
  • Ensure full compliance with all local, national, and international HSE regulations.
  • Implement and enforce company HSE policies, standards, and procedures.
  • Conduct risk assessments and ensure that proper controls are implemented.
  • Identify potential hazards and recommend corrective actions.
  • Monitor HSE performance and prepare regular reports for segment and region.
  • Analyze incident trends and develop improvement plans.
  • Organize and facilitate HSE training programs and drills.
  • Build HSE awareness and positive safety culture.
  • Lead incident investigations, root cause analysis, and follow-up on corrective actions.
  • Conduct internal HSE audits and manage other relevant HSE audits.
  • Perform regular site inspections and safety walkthroughs.
  • Liaise with regulatory bodies, emergency services, and other stakeholders as required.
  • Communicate HSE requirements and initiatives across departments.
